1. Heart Health: The Brew’s Benefit
Studies have shown that moderate beer consumption can be associated with a reduced risk of heart disease. The presence of certain antioxidants in beer, such as polyphenols, can contribute to cardiovascular health by helping to reduce inflammation and improve blood vessel function.
2. Bone Health: Strength in Every Sip
Beer contains dietary silicon, a mineral that is linked to bone health. Moderate beer consumption has been associated with higher bone mineral density, potentially reducing the risk of osteoporosis and fractures, particularly in older adults.
3. Brain Boost: Mental Benefits of a Brew
Moderate beer consumption has been linked to improved cognitive function and a reduced risk of cognitive decline in older adults. Certain compounds in beer, such as xanthohumol, have shown neuroprotective properties, which could help maintain brain health as we age.
